
Professional groomers and mobile stylists know that high-velocity drying is the backbone of efficient coat prep, de-shedding treatments, and post-bath finishing. The High Power Dual Motor Pet Dryer delivers sustained, high-pressure airflow that lifts outer guard hairs while pulling trapped moisture from deep within the undercoat. This matters most for double-coated breeds such as Huskies, Golden Retrievers, and Samoyeds, where lingering dampness can lead to matting, odor, or hot spots. Unlike single-motor units that lose pressure during extended sessions, this machine uses two independently cooled 1,200W motors to maintain consistent blast force from start to finish. For teams searching for a reliable High Velocity Dual Motor Dog Blower, the stepless airflow dial offers precise control from a gentle 20 m/s breeze for faces and ears up to a forceful 65 m/s for dense rear quarters. Four heat modes—cool, warm, high, and turbo—make it safe for brachycephalic breeds in the cool setting while remaining aggressive enough for thick farm coats. The outer shell is reinforced with glass-filled nylon that shrugs off daily bumps in a busy salon, and the internal air channel is engineered to reduce turbulence, holding operating noise to just 68 dB at one meter. Less noise means lower stress for noise-sensitive dogs and less fatigue for groomers who run dryers six or more hours a day. Maintenance is equally practical: a washable foam filter captures dander before it reaches the motor, and the filter tray slides out without tools for quick cleaning between grooms.
The High Power Dual Motor Pet Dryer weighs only 4.2 kg, yet it sits solidly on anti-vibration rubber feet to prevent sliding on metal grooming tables. A molded carry handle is built into the top of the housing, so you can lift the unit with one hand while guiding the hose with the other. The included 2.5-meter hose is constructed from flexible PVC with steel wire reinforcement, eliminating the kinks that often choke airflow during busy appointments. At the nozzle end, a 360-degree swivel prevents twisting as you move around a dog. Three quick-snap nozzles—flat, round, and wide-slot—cover a full range of coat types: the flat nozzle concentrates air for raking out undercoat, the round nozzle provides an all-purpose stream, and the wide-slot nozzle diffuses air for kittens, puppies, and senior pets. Independent heat and airflow controls sit on the front panel with clearly labeled dials, so even new staff can operate the dryer safely after a two-minute demonstration. A built-in overheat sensor automatically cuts power if the motor temperature exceeds safe limits, protecting both the pet and the equipment. The dryer also includes a hanging loop for wall-mounted storage and a 2-year limited warranty covering motor and electrical defects. For mobile vans, the compact footprint of 33 × 22 × 20 cm saves valuable counter space, while the 240 CFM output rivals dryers nearly twice its size. With UL/CE certification and a standard 110–120V plug, it runs on ordinary North American outlets without special wiring or transformers.
